Output 57508697bdfbb61bc1a8d2ee9343dbea8f9758bd60cb9f6bd5f3fbd5b7103f73:0

value
270276
script pubkey
OP_0 OP_PUSHBYTES_20 ea7fa8b81c0d5f9f89f5f0b0012b88ebe6a7b5c6
address
bc1qafl63wqup40elz047zcqz2uga0n20dwxze8nlg
transaction
57508697bdfbb61bc1a8d2ee9343dbea8f9758bd60cb9f6bd5f3fbd5b7103f73
confirmations
44153
spent
true